About Decolic Infant oral Drop

Decolic Infant oral Drop belongs to the class of 'digestants', primarily used for treating infant colic pain and griping pain. Colic pain/abdominal pain occurs between the chest and pelvic regions. Pain can be crampy, achy, dull, intermittent, or sharp. Your child can experience generalized symptoms like belching, nausea, and vomiting. 

Decolic Infant oral Drop contains Dimethicone, fennel oil and Dil oil. Dimethicone is an antifoaming medicine that disintegrates gas bubbles and allows easy gas passage. In contrast, fennel oil and Dil oil are herbal medicines which help to increase the movement of the stomach and intestines to push food through the digestive system. They also relieve muscle spasms in the gut. 

Decolic Infant oral Drop should be used as suggested by your doctor. Shake the bottle before use. The drops can be mixed with 30 ml (2 tablespoons) of water or another liquid to make administration easier. In some cases, your child may experience certain common side effects, such as constipation, diarrhoea, and intestinal pain. Most of these side effects resolve on their own. If these side effects persist, stop using this medicine and contact your doctor immediately.

Before starting Decolic Infant oral Drop, please inform your doctor if your child has any allergy to Decolic Infant oral Drop. Decolic Infant oral Drop is safe to be used in liver and kidney diseases. However, use this medicine with the doctor's suggested only.
